ObjectList.ViewMode Свойство

Определение

Получает или задает режим просмотра списка объектов ObjectList. Этот API устарел. Сведения о разработке ASP.NET мобильных приложений см. в статье Мобильные приложения & сайты с ASP.NET.

public:
 property System::Web::UI::MobileControls::ObjectListViewMode ViewMode { System::Web::UI::MobileControls::ObjectListViewMode get(); void set(System::Web::UI::MobileControls::ObjectListViewMode value); };
[System.ComponentModel.Bindable(false)]
[System.ComponentModel.Browsable(false)]
public System.Web.UI.MobileControls.ObjectListViewMode ViewMode { get; set; }
[<System.ComponentModel.Bindable(false)>]
[<System.ComponentModel.Browsable(false)>]
member this.ViewMode : System.Web.UI.MobileControls.ObjectListViewMode with get, set
Public Property ViewMode As ObjectListViewMode

Значение свойства

Значение ObjectListViewMode представляет режим просмотра списка объектов.

Атрибуты

Исключения

Предпринята попытка задать для этого свойства значение, отличное от List, в то время как не выбрано ни одного элемента.

Комментарии

В перечислении ObjectListViewMode для этого свойства доступны следующие параметры.

Имя элемента Описание
List Это представление по умолчанию, отображаемое, когда первый раз выполняется отрисовка страницы, содержащей список объектов. Он состоит из полей меток элементов или, если TableFields свойство не пусто, таблицы со столбцами, соответствующими полям и строкам таблицы для элементов. В HTML это представление сочетается с представлением "Команды", а команды отображаются в виде гиперссылок под списком. При наличии дополнительных сведений в представлении Сведений отображается гиперссылка для каждого элемента, отображающего представление Сведений.
Details В HTML это представление сочетается с представлением "Команды", а команды отображаются в виде гиперссылок под подробными сведениями.
Commands Отрисовка этого представления производится отдельно только для WML-устройств. Он состоит из меню с командами ObjectList. Для устройств HTML представления списка и сведения объединены с этим представлением, а команды отображаются в виде гиперссылок под сведениями или списком.

Примечание

Чтобы задать это свойство в коде, необходимо выбрать элемент в списке, прежде чем присвоить этому свойству значение Commands или Details просмотреть. Попытка задать свойство перед выбором элемента вызывает исключение.

Режим представления сохраняется в состоянии закрытого представления, поэтому, независимо от того, является trueли EnableViewState свойство ObjectList объекта , режим представления сохраняется как частное поле. Однако если EnableViewState свойство имеет значение false, коллекция элементов не сохраняется между запросами, поэтому привязка данных должна повторяться для каждого запроса.

Применяется к

См. также раздел